Yep, it is possible. A company called RAM Mounts let’s you mount almost anything to almost anything. They have a big section on their website just for GPS products, covering all the big names such as Garmin, Magellan, Lowrance, TomTom, etc… You can get a suction cup mount for your windshield, or just a flat surface mount, handlebar mount for your bicycle, or a clutch mount for your motorcycle… a huge selection. Pictured above is what they call a triple base adapter.
Related:The RAP-333 allows up to three items to be mounted side by side off a single RAM mount. It’s almost like creating a dash board allowing easy access and viewing of your portable devices. Best used with a durable aluminum RAM kit, installation and adjustments are easy. This is a great option when space is limited or proximity is necessary so devices can be linked.
